Advanced Techniques for Epoch Conversion
Every developer, tips analyst, or tech fanatic has faced it: a protracted string of numbers like1672531200 in region of an accurate date. These numbers are timestamps, representing seconds considering January 1, 1970, which is called the Unix epoch. On their personal, they may be exact but opaque. Converting them to readable dates seriously is not just a convenience—it’s indispensable for studying logs, coping with databases, and syncing methods across one-of-a-kind time zones.Why Timestamp To Date Conversion Matters
Timestamps are all over the world, from server logs in New York to IoT sensor info in Berlin. They allow machines to method occasions adequately, but humans want context. Imagine tracking a webpage’s site visitors and seeing a spike at
1681344000. Without conversion, it’s not possible to correlate that spike with genuine consumer conduct or neighborhood pursuits.Conversion from timestamp so far bridges this hole. It turns raw desktop details into insights that persons can act on, whether or not for debugging code, producing reports, or tracking monetary transactions. Businesses relying on true-time analytics, noticeably in international operations, is not going to come up with the money for ambiguity in time info.
Common Use Cases for Timestamp To Date Conversion
Understanding while routine befell is the wide-spread motive, yet functional purposes lengthen extra. A few eventualities illustrate this:
- Server Logs: Determining targeted times for system errors or get right of entry to situations.
- Database Management: Converting stored epoch values for reporting or integration.
- Data Analysis: Aggregating metrics with the aid of day, week, or month.
- Global Collaboration: Coordinating pursuits throughout the different time zones.
- Financial Transactions: Verifying timestamps in buying and selling systems or blockchain logs.
Each of those cases benefits from top timestamp to this point conversion. Even a minor misalignment can bring about hours of bewilderment whilst interpreting archives.
Technical Insights: How Timestamp Conversion Works
A timestamp is a count number of seconds (or milliseconds) from the epoch. Converting it to a date comes to three steps:
- Determine the unit: seconds or milliseconds.
- Apply an appropriate time quarter offset, if priceless.
- Format the resulting date string in a human-readable pattern.
Most programming languages present integrated utilities for this process. In Python, you would possibly use
datetime.fromtimestamp(), even as JavaScript promises new Date(). For difficult approaches, fairly the ones processing thousands and thousands of parties consistent with day, correct and powerfuble conversion will become a principal engineering determination.Time Zones and Daylight Savings
Conversion isn't very as straightforward as simply formatting numbers. Time zones and sunlight hours reductions introduce diffused demanding situations. A timestamp that represents middle of the night UTC could correspond to the old nighttime in Los Angeles or the early morning in Tokyo. For prone with customers throughout continents, failing to account for nearby time modifications can intent misinterpretation of statistics and person interest.
Practical Tips for Reliable Timestamp Conversion
Even experienced developers sometimes fail to notice those functional concerns:
- Always assess the unit: Confusing seconds with milliseconds can produce dates lots of years off.
- Include express time zones: Never count on the procedure defaults tournament your target market.
- Standardize formatting: ISO 8601 is largely adopted and decreases ambiguity.
- Test facet circumstances: Leap years, sunlight financial savings, and finish-of-month calculations.
- Use reliable libraries: Avoid ad-hoc calculations for mission-extreme functions.
Timestamp To Date in Real-World Applications
Consider an e-trade platform monitoring orders throughout Europe and the U.S. The raw order timestamps are saved in UTC. Customer aid agents in Berlin desire the local order time to address inquiries correctly. By changing timestamps to human-readable dates with the right time quarter applied, teams can reply turbo and with fewer mistakes. This is simply not theoretical—it’s operational effectivity.
Another instance comes from IoT analytics. A sensible electricity grid in California collects sensor readings every 2nd. Engineers reading functionality need to correlate parties with grid anomalies in local time, no longer UTC. Proper timestamp conversion lets in them to perceive patterns and act earlier minor disorders improve into outages.
Choosing the Right Tool for Conversion
There are many tactics to transform timestamps, from programming libraries to on line utilities. The choice relies on context:
- For developers: Language-express libraries (Python, JavaScript, Java) give programmatic flexibility.
- For analysts: Spreadsheet applications in Excel or Google Sheets deal with batch conversion effectually.
- For short assessments: Online converters are swift, sturdy, and cast off the chance of handbook miscalculations.
The secret's consistency. Using a relied on, standardized technique ensures that dates stay accurate throughout all systems and experiences.
Future-Proofing Timestamp Handling
As tactics become more and more worldwide, precision in time dealing with grows in importance. Cloud systems, microservices, and dispensed databases require constant timestamp to this point conversions to stay clear of cascading errors. Engineers more and more rely on automated pipelines that validate and convert timestamps formerly they succeed in selection-makers. This reduces the menace of misinterpretation and enhances operational reliability.
In life like phrases, this indicates integrating conversion instruments into dashboards, logs, and analytics pipelines. Even a minor misalignment in time handling can ripple thru reporting, billing, and efficiency tracking, exceedingly whilst varied regions are in contact.
Conclusion: Making Timestamps Useful
Working with timestamps is more than a technical practice. It is set clarity, accuracy, and operational efficiency. Whether you are interpreting server logs, tracking international approaches, or studying consumer behavior, converting timestamps to readable dates is imperative for instructed judgements. For any person desiring a dependableremember, clean-to-use answer, Timestamp To Date gives you a straightforward tool to seriously change raw epoch numbers into significant human-readable dates, supporting clients shop time and decrease blunders in equally expert and private initiatives.